[PATCH net-next v5 0/2] netconsole: allow selection of egress interface via MAC address

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



This series adds support for selecting a netconsole egress interface by
specifying the MAC address (in place of the interface name) in the
boot/module parameter.

Changes in v5:
- Drop Breno Leitao's patch to add (non-RCU) dev_getbyhwaddr from this
  set since it has landed on net-next (Jakub Kicinski)
- Link to v4: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20250217-netconsole-v4-0-0c681cef71f1@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x

Changes in v4:
- Incorporate Breno Leitao's patch to add (non-RCU) dev_getbyhwaddr and
  use it (Jakub Kicinski)
- Use MAC_ADDR_STR_LEN in ieee80211_sta_debugfs_add as well (Michal
  Swiatkowski)
- Link to v3: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20250205-netconsole-v3-0-132a31f17199@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x

Changes in v3:
- Rename MAC_ADDR_LEN to MAC_ADDR_STR_LEN (Johannes Berg)
- Link to v2: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20250204-netconsole-v2-0-5ef5eb5f6056@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x
